Handover: Inkmill markdown pipeline

Taking over from me on the Inkmill rendering pipeline? Short version: plugins register transforms against the pre-render hook, and the sanitizer runs last — don't fight it, it wins. External plugin authors keep tripping on the fence-block parser; point them at the extension spec, not the core source. Builds go through the Larchgate runner, which caches transform output aggressively, so bump the cache key whenever a plugin changes its output shape. Everything the plugin host reads at boot is listed here.

deployment values, fahap-hahaf:
[casdor]
port = 9200
region = south-2
host = casdor.qirvanworks.corp
timeout_ms = 3000
retries = 4

Driver-assignment heuristic (Cartwheel v3): if assignment latency exceeds 800ms or unfilled-ride rate tops 5%, flip the fallback flag to round-robin before cutting the release. Do not ship a build with the heuristic in degraded mode. Verify flag state in staging first. Rollback steps and flag details are documented on this page.

operations page: https://harbor.zarqeldata.local/deploy/ticket/board/dash/board/display/dash/58c2ec1e4245aecb18b1fc8f

# Runbook: Hunting leaked file descriptors in Quillgate

When the `fd_open` gauge climbs steadily between deploys, suspect a leak rather than load. First confirm on a single pod: exec in and count entries under `/proc/1/fd`, noting how many are sockets in CLOSE_WAIT versus regular files. Capture two snapshots ten minutes apart before restarting anything — we need the delta for the postmortem. Reproduce locally with the Marbury load harness, which requires the service running with the following configuration values.

settings of yagep-bajog:
[istdor]
port = 4000
region = south-2
host = istdor.qorvelcorp.internal
timeout_ms = 5000
retries = 5